Algeria, a North African country rich in history and culture, often finds itself at the intersection of various geopolitical dynamics. One way to understand the complexities of Algeria is by examining it through the lens of a matrix, where different factors and influences intersect to shape its present and future. At the core of Algeria's matrix is its history of colonization and struggle for independence. The legacy of French colonial rule continues to impact the country's politics, economy, and society to this day. Algeria's fight for independence was bloody and protracted, leaving deep scars that still resonate through its politics. Another key factor in Algeria's matrix is its energy resources, particularly oil and gas. These resources have long been the backbone of Algeria's economy, providing the government with significant revenue. However, they also make the country vulnerable to fluctuations in global energy markets and expose it to the risk of a resource curse. Algeria's strategic location in North Africa also plays a pivotal role in its matrix. Situated between the Mediterranean Sea, Europe, and the rest of Africa, Algeria serves as a bridge between different regions. This has both benefits and challenges, as the country must navigate complex regional dynamics and balance its relationships with neighboring countries. The matrix of Algeria is further complicated by its internal politics and society. Ethnic and sectarian divisions, economic inequalities, and authoritarian governance all contribute to the country's internal dynamics. Challenges such as youth unemployment, corruption, and lack of political freedoms add layers of complexity to Algeria's matrix.
